Assistant Professor – New Media (Web Design and Development)

Tenure-track

 

The Department of New Media at the University of Lethbridge invites applications for a full-time, tenure-track position at the rank of Assistant Professor, commencing July 1, 2018. This position is subject to the approval of the Board of Governors.

An M.F.A. or equivalent terminal degree is required combined with a demonstrated record of creative activity and/or scholarly research in the area of web design and development, as well as demonstrated excellence in teaching. The successful candidate will have excellent web design and development skills including:

  • extensive experience in the creative exploration of emerging and integrated web technologies and specifications (e.g., d3.js, p5.js, Flexbox, etc.),
  • understanding of the web’s cultural, political, economic, and environmental implications
  • fluency in best practices and current W3C standards including responsive web design, HTML5, CSS3, Javascript and JQuery

In addition, expertise with hybrid mobile application development would be an asset.

The University aspires to hire individuals who have demonstrated excellence in teaching and research/creative activity, and have the potential to contribute actively in the Department of New Media and the Faculty of Fine Arts. Course assignments will be primarily undergraduate courses in web design and development, as well as other courses in the candidate’s area of expertise. These would include: (1) Web Design and Development, (2) the Dynamic Web, and (3) Advanced Web Design. Additional desirable attributes include an ability to teach (1) a foundational New Media introductory course, (2) the History and Theory of New Media, (3) and/or a special topic based on demonstrable proficiencies. Successful candidates will also be expected to serve in the M.F.A. New Media graduate program.

The Faculty of Fine Arts offers degree programs in Art, Drama, Music, and New Media within a liberal education context, and focuses on excellence in teaching and research/creative activity. The Centre for the Arts features outstanding equipment, facilities, and staff. The Department of New Media offers four degree programs: a B.F.A., a combined B.F.A/BMgt., a combined B.F.A./B.Ed., and an M.F.A. in New Media.  For more information about the Department of New Media, the University of Lethbridge, and the City of Lethbridge, please visit our websites at:
